SPECTRUM

SuPErConducTing Radio-frequency switch for qUantuM technologies

Quantum computers can spur the development of new breakthroughs in science and technology, tackling problems that today’s conventional computers cannot handle. The low number of qubits that hardware can support and the large number of required cables are preventing the technology from making a bigger market penetration. The EU-funded SPECTRUM project will develop technology to remarkably simplify the control over multiple qubits through the same cable. Researchers will develop a switch whose superconductive core will operate at frequencies unachievable with classical semiconductor electronic components and with nearly zero power dissipation. The new switch will also lower related downtime, cost and overall space occupied by the hardware.
